Coin Center takes aim at ‘unconstitutional’ SEC redefinition of an ‘exchange’
Nonprofit blockchain advocacy group Coin Center has called the Securities and Exchange Commission’s (SEC) proposed redefinition of an “exchange” an “unconstitutional overreach.” The lobby group made the comments in a written response to the SEC’s March 18 Amendments Regarding the Definition of “Exchange”, which details changing the meaning of “exchange” from a “system that brings together the orders” of a security to one that “brings together buyers and sellers.” The SEC’s proposed rule to change the definition of “exchange.” Bringing together orders, which are things, is very different to bringing…

Ripple scores ‘a very big win’ in SEC case
Ripple Labs has struck a blow against the Securities and Exchange Commission’s (SEC) case after the presiding judge made a ruling that one Ripple community lawyer calls “a very big win for Ripple.” The SEC filed suit in 2020 against Ripple and executives Brad Garlinghouse and Christian Larsen for selling unregistered securities. Presiding Judge Sarah Netburn denied the SEC’s request to reconsider shielding documents under privilege related to a June, 2018 speech made by Ripple’s then-director Willian Hinman.
